We consider the problem of image registration in the case of a radial deformation around an unknown center. We propose a novel approach for the estimation of the radial distortion parameters, which is applicable for camera calibration and image correction. We present a novel method of exploiting noise reduction prior to mode selection in classification-based speech coding. Certain parameter estimation and mode selection is performed on a denoised signal to ideally remove the non-speech components before signal classification, although the original input is coded. In this paper we present methods enabling the analysis and detection of the Universal Mobile Telecommunications System (UMTS) signals. Presented procedures enable estimation of the basic parameters of the signal, identification of the standard and provide knowledge concerning essential information about the transmitted signal.
